Bill Brown in November this year achieved an amazing milestone of 25 years of service as a volunteer at the Greater Shepparton Visitor Centre, and celebrated this achievement yesterday at a presentation ceremony at the Shepparton Golf Club.
Bill was presented with a certificate for his achievement by Cr Kim O’Keeffe, Deputy Mayor, later enjoying an afternoon tea.
Bill commenced his volunteering services at the Visitor Information Centre on 21 November 1991 after retiring from the workforce. 25 years and approximately 10,000 hours of volunteering later, Bill still continues to devote his time to the community.
Greater Shepparton City Council Director Sustainable Development Johann Rajaratnam described Bill as a most reliable, passionate and personable volunteer team member.
“Bill’s achievement is a great story for all and we appreciate his exceptional services over the past 25 years.
“Bill’s willingness to share his passion and stories about Greater Shepparton has been remarkable, and his incredible wealth of knowledge about Shepparton’s history and current happenings has provided assistance and benefit to visitors and members of our community.
“He has a great ability to engage visitors to Greater Shepparton, building rapport and making connections with almost all visitors he meets by adding personal touches in his volunteering role. We thank Bill for his dedication over the past 25 years and hope to see many more great times with him in the future,” said Mr Rajaratnam.
Bill volunteers every Thursday morning from 9am to 1pm at the Greater Shepparton Visitor Centre, located at 33-35 Nixon Street Shepparton.
Greater Shepparton City Council thank Bill, along with all our wonderful volunteers, who help us provide a variety of services for our local commuity and visitors.
